Alphabet Q4 2021 Earnings Report
Key Takeaways
Alphabet Inc. reported Q4 2021 revenues of $75.325 billion, a 32% increase year-over-year, driven by strong advertiser spend, consumer online activity, and Google Cloud growth. Diluted EPS was $30.69. The Board of Directors approved a 20-for-one stock split.
Q4 revenues reached $75.325 billion, up 32% year-over-year.
Google Cloud continues to experience substantial ongoing revenue growth.
Quarterly sales record achieved for Pixel phones despite supply constraints.
Board of Directors approved a 20-for-one stock split.
